History:

SHRIKRUSHNA, a name brimming with devotion and charm! This name beautifully combines "Shri," meaning auspicious or prosperous, and "Krishna," the beloved Hindu god. Its a theophoric name—a name including a divine element—so its origin is tied to stories about Lord Krishna. Many names for this god, including Krishna, come from mythology, each showing a different side of his personality or a key moment in his life. The "Shri" adds respect and good fortune, emphasizing Krishnas divine nature. So, the story of this names origin is deeply connected to the many tales of Lord Krishnas life, from childhood fun to his amazing deeds and teachings. These stories are in the Bhagavata Purana and other Hindu scriptures, giving a rich collection of stories explaining this beloved god and, therefore, names like SHRIKRUSHNA.

Krishnas story is deeply woven into Indian culture. His birth is celebrated with Janmashtami, a huge party, and Holi, another big festival, highlights his fun-loving side. Radha, his beloved, is also a significant figure in these celebrations.

SHRIKRUSHNAs name has cool variations! Krishna is a simpler version, while Shri Krishna adds respect. Regional dialects change the spelling and pronunciation a bit, but the meaning stays the same. You might see Shreekrishna, or nicknames like Krish or Shru. It all depends on where someones from and how they like to use the name. Family might use a short version, while formal events use the full, respectful one. Lots of versions show how popular this name is.
